What scale of population is suggested as the critical mass for the Martian community to begin functioning independently?
Answer
Perhaps a thousand individuals.
The vision for the Martian city extends beyond simply housing modules; it requires achieving a functional, growing community. To reach the point where this community can sustain itself and begin to operate independently without constant reliance on Earth-based supply chains, a minimum threshold of people is necessary. This critical mass is estimated to be approximately one thousand individuals, allowing institutions and necessary social structures to begin forming organically.
